The CME FedWatch tool indicates a 79% probability that the Federal Reserve will keep interest rates unchanged in January 2026. The likelihood of a 25-basis-point rate cut stands at 21%. Looking ahead to March 2026, the probability of a rate cut increases to 47.1%, while the chance of maintaining current rates decreases to 43.4%.
